Switching between cameras in QGC
-
Hello,
I have a Starling v2 max with VOXL2 and when I connect to QGround Control I can see the images sent by the front camera. I want to switch between those and the images coming from the camera facing down, how can I do that?

@LR If you just want to change the camera that is streaming then modify
/etc/modalai/voxl-streamer.confto specify the desired camera. If you want to stream two or more cameras then you need to start a voxl-streamer instance for each one and specify a different port for each one. Then usevoxl-mavcam-managerto inform QGC of the availability of the multiple streams. See https://docs.modalai.com/voxl-mavcam-manager/
